The P6SMB91CAT3 is a unidirectional TVS diode with two pins: 1. Anode (A) 2. Cathode (K)
The P6SMB91CAT3 operates by diverting excess current away from sensitive components when an overvoltage event occurs. When the voltage exceeds the breakdown voltage, the diode conducts and clamps the voltage to a safe level, protecting downstream components.
The P6SMB91CAT3 is commonly used in various electronic systems, including: - Power supplies - Communication equipment - Automotive electronics - Industrial control systems - Consumer electronics
